ESJC – RUG SUPPLY AND CLEANING BID
Solicitation # esjc-rug-supply-cleaning-bid
This solicitation seeks bids for rug supply and cleaning services at the Excelsior Springs Job Corps Center in Missouri under a subcontracting opportunity with a deadline of August 14, 2026, at 12 p.m. CST. The contract requires the vendor to furnish clean rugs on a weekly basis, replacing soiled ones and managing their cleaning for the next cycle, with full responsibility for site assessment, delivery, placement, and maintenance of all rugs throughout the performance period from October 1, 2026, to September 30, 2027. Services are priced on a fee-for-service basis, and bidders must submit a completed Bid Sheet with a detailed cost breakdown, including labor, materials, transportation, and supervision, without additional charges for packing unless explicitly accepted by ETR. All proposals must include mandatory documentation such as Form W-9, Vendor Acknowledgement Form, applicable FFATA and Anti-Lobbying Certifications, Certificates of Insurance, Missouri licensing credentials, and a proposed service schedule. The winning bidder must maintain an active SAM.gov registration with a Unique Entity ID and comply with federal regulations including the Service Contract Act, minimum wage requirements under EO 14026, debarment certification, and dissemination of information rules. The contract is subject to strict site-specific standards, including adherence to OSHA, NFPA 101, and the National Electrical Code, and all personnel must observe center security policies, including prohibitions on fraternization, tobacco, alcohol, drugs, and firearms. Performance is F.O.B. destination, with inspections required at the site and final payment contingent upon submission of a signed punch list and warranties. Payment terms are net 30 days after invoicing, and award will be based on best overall value, not necessarily the lowest bid. The solicitation is set aside for small business categories including SDB, WOSB, HUBZone SB, VOSB, and SDVOSB, and contractors must adhere to ETR’s Affirmative Action Plan and Davis Bacon Act wage determinations. Proposals must be physically delivered in a clearly labeled envelope to the procurement contact at the specified Missouri address.

PEO-M Unmanned Surface Vehicle (USV) Poseidon's Fury Collaboration Event (CE)
Solicitation # PEO_M_USV_Poseidon_s_Fury_CE
SOFWERX and the USSOCOM Program Executive Office Maritime (PEO-M) are hosting the Poseidon’s Fury Collaboration Event to accelerate the development of the Unmanned Surface Vehicle Mission-Aligned Reference Architecture (MARA), a standards-based framework designed to improve interoperability across Joint Force manned and unmanned maritime systems while eliminating redundant, service-specific platform development. This initiative is open exclusively to U.S. persons and involves a two-phase process beginning with a virtual collaboration event on August 26, 2026, where SOF operators and industry partners will engage in breakout sessions to define operational needs around user interface, autonomy, command and control, and platform effectiveness. Participation in this event is optional but strongly encouraged to align solutions with warfighter requirements, with registration closing August 14, 2026. Those who do not attend the CE may still submit capabilities for consideration during the Assessment Event, which opens on September 14, 2026, and closes October 2, 2026. A virtual Q&A session is available on September 23 for clarification on technical expectations. Selected submissions will undergo a downselect process, with winners invited to participate in a comprehensive on-water Assessment Event at Stennis Space Center, Mississippi, between November 2 and 20, 2026. Participants must demonstrate their USV capabilities in real-world conditions, with evaluations conducted by Subject Matter Experts from USSOCOM, JHU APL, WARCOM, and MARSOC using predefined technical and operational criteria. Successful performers may be transitioned to Phase 5, where potential pathways for follow-on acquisition include Other Transaction Authorities (OTAs) under 10 U.S.C. §4022, research agreements under 15 U.S.C. §3715, cooperative R&D agreements, experimental procurement under §4023, or prize competitions—potentially leading to non-competitive production awards based on successful prototype outcomes. All awardees must comply with NIST SP 800-171 for securing Controlled Unclassified Information, and eligibility is limited to U.S. persons and organizations capable of supporting USSOCOM’s unique maritime missions.

MARSOC: Automated Armory Collaboration Event (CE)
Solicitation # MARSOC_Automated_Armory_CE
MARSOC, in partnership with SOFWERX, is inviting U.S. industry, academia, and national laboratories to collaboratively develop a revolutionary automated armory system that eliminates manual inventory processes through a fully passive, image-based tracking solution. The initiative targets the modernization of serialized weapon and equipment accountability by replacing paper logs, handwritten forms, and RFID or radio-frequency systems with secure optical recognition and computer vision technologies. Participants are challenged to design a system that authenticates users via CAC, automatically logs equipment issuance and recovery through photographic scans, tracks item locations, and maintains tamper-proof audit trails—all without emitting any RF signals to preserve operational security. The effort is driven by the need to reduce human error, minimize administrative burden, and ensure absolute accountability in high-stakes special operations environments. The collaboration unfolds in stages: first, a mandatory submission deadline of 16 August 2026 for attendance at the in-person Collaboration Event on 17 September 2026 at SOFWERX in Florida, where stakeholders will engage directly with warfighters to refine requirements. Those unable to attend may still submit solutions by 20 October 2026 for the Assessment Event, which includes a virtual Q&A on 3 November and a downselect by 1 December. Finalists will present live demonstrations during the Assessment Event from 15 to 17 December 2026, with top-performing solutions potentially entering into non-traditional agreements under 10 U.S.C. Sections 4021, 4022, or other alternative contracting authorities such as OTAs, CRADAs, or prize competitions. Selected participants must comply with NIST SP 800-171 for handling Controlled Unclassified Information. Only U.S. persons and U.S. industry entities are eligible to participate, and success in this event may lead directly to follow-on production agreements without additional competition.
